INCREASE INTERNET SITE EFFICIENCY WITH EXPERT DRUPAL MAINTENANCE APPROACHES

Increase Internet site Efficiency with Expert Drupal Maintenance Approaches

Increase Internet site Efficiency with Expert Drupal Maintenance Approaches

Blog Article

Comprehending the necessity of Drupal Servicing
Exactly what is Drupal Servicing?
Drupal maintenance refers to the ongoing strategy of making certain that a Drupal Web page operates effortlessly, securely, and competently. This encompasses various tasks ranging from normal software program updates, protection patches, efficiency enhancements, and material administration, to backups and checking. Normal Drupal Routine maintenance will help to avoid downtime, assures the newest characteristics are executed, and keeps the website compliant with existing World wide web benchmarks.

Why Standard Updates Make any difference for Security
Security is amongst the Most important fears for virtually any Web page, and Drupal is no exception. Typical updates are important to guard the website from vulnerabilities that malicious entities could exploit. Just about every new edition of Drupal comes with fixes for recognized security problems, making it crucial to stay up-to-date. Failure to put into practice these updates can lead to info breaches, loss of delicate information and facts, and harm to your standing.

The Impact of Routine maintenance on Performance
The maintenance schedule substantially impacts an internet site’s performance. Devoid of normal checks and updates, a Drupal web page may load gradually or behave unpredictably, bringing about a bad person practical experience. Regular servicing can optimize performance by cleaning up unused modules and themes, optimizing the databases, and making certain that caching mechanisms are efficiently utilized. These improvements add to faster load instances, boosting consumer satisfaction and possibly boosting Web optimization rankings.

Prevalent Problems in Drupal Upkeep
Figuring out Typical Troubles and Their Alternatives
Protecting a Drupal internet site isn't without the need of its difficulties. Widespread challenges consist of plugin conflicts, server misconfigurations, and outdated themes. Determining these issues normally includes checking logs, effectiveness metrics, and person responses. Answers can range between systematic troubleshooting, testing updates inside a staging natural environment, or consulting with knowledgeable to carry out the necessary fixes. Typical audits could also assist in identifying probable problems before they escalate.

Controlling Third-Party Modules and Plugins
Drupal’s substantial ecosystem of third-celebration modules can considerably enhance operation. However, they can also introduce vulnerabilities and compatibility issues. It’s necessary to vet Each individual module properly in advance of set up and often assessment and update them. Preserving communication with module builders through community forums may also provide insights into possible concerns and forthcoming updates. Moreover, creating a rigorous examination suite can stop problematic modules from leading to disruptions on your Reside web site.

Dealing with Drupal Model Updates Effortlessly
Upgrading Drupal to a newer Edition can considerably improve operation and safety, nonetheless it comes along with dangers. System updates can crack compatibility with present themes and modules. Therefore, it can be a good idea to follow an in depth improve prepare that features back again-ups and a tests section in the non-production surroundings. Also, leveraging automatic up grade scripts can streamline this method even though minimizing faults and downtime.

Ideal Practices for Successful Drupal Routine maintenance
Creating a Upkeep Program
Creating a upkeep agenda is crucial in making certain no element of your Drupal web page is forgotten. This program should outline certain tasks being finished day-to-day, weekly, every month, and each year. Daily jobs could possibly contain monitoring stability alerts and checking internet site functionality, even though weekly tasks may involve updating content material and checking for offered updates. Month-to-month and yearly jobs can incorporate thorough backups, performance audits, and security critiques. Consistence in your upkeep regime helps preemptively address opportunity issues.

Making use of Automated Applications for Efficiency
Automation can considerably lessen the workload linked to Drupal maintenance. There are potent equipment which can help with tasks which include checking, backups, and updates. Instruments like Drush or Aegir can automate various duties, ensuring that the website is consistently current without the need of handbook intervention. Additionally, essential checking solutions can warn you of any downtime or performance issues, making it possible for for swift motion to resolve them in advance of they escalate.

Conducting Normal Performance Audits
Overall performance audits are essential for assessing your Drupal web site’s efficiency and speed. By utilizing numerous performance metrics for example web site load time, server response time, and throughput, you'll be able to form a clear photograph of how efficiently your internet site operates. Conducting audits regularly permits you to pinpoint areas for advancement, assisting to apply optimizations that can cause a better user practical experience and improved Website positioning performance.

Sophisticated Methods for Optimizing Drupal Maintenance
Leveraging Caching Methods
Caching is a strong system in World-wide-web efficiency optimization, and it plays an important purpose in Drupal servicing. By configuring caching adequately applying applications like Varnish or the created-in caching mechanisms in Drupal, websites can appreciably decrease load times and server load. Caching methods include things like web page caching for whole rendered internet pages, block caching for dynamic articles, and sights caching for database queries, which could drastically improve website responsiveness and lessen source intake.

Checking Internet site Well being with Analytics
Analytics applications supply worthwhile insights into your internet site’s general performance and user interactions. Utilizing Google Analytics or other similar equipment can track consumer behavior, website traffic resources, and engagement metrics, all of which tell determination-producing and tactic. Frequently examining this data aids in determining traits and likely complications though enabling you to tailor your articles and effectiveness optimally, keeping your people engaged and contented.

Integrating Backup Remedies Effectively
Backups certainly are a significant facet of Drupal servicing, guaranteeing that you could rapidly Get better from any knowledge decline or site failure. An effective backup solution consists of not merely frequent automated backups of information and databases and also proper testing to ensure that backups is usually restored. Leveraging instruments for instance Backup and Migrate, which happens to be especially made for Drupal, can considerably streamline this process, providing satisfaction that your info is preserved should any challenges crop up.

Measuring Results in Drupal Upkeep
Key General performance Metrics to Track
To correctly measure the achievements within your Drupal upkeep endeavours, unique crucial performance indicators (KPIs) should be tracked. These can contain web page uptime, common load time, responsiveness to consumer requests, security incident occurrences, and person actions analytics. Creating very clear benchmarks for these KPIs will assist you to gauge advancement over time and refine your upkeep tactics proficiently.

Analyzing Person Encounter Write-up-Servicing
Publish-maintenance evaluations are fundamental in examining the effectiveness within your efforts. Collecting consumer opinions by way of surveys or direct interaction can supply important insights into their activities just before and following upkeep. Also, checking engagement metrics, for instance bounce rates or session durations, get more info will give information to grasp the impression within your routine maintenance activities on person gratification and retention.

Generating Information-Pushed Improvements
The importance of details-driven insights can’t be overstated in developing a powerful maintenance program. Analysing the data obtained from general performance metrics, consumer feed-back, and analytics will permit you to apply informed alterations. This allows for ongoing improvement of your website, making sure it meets consumer expectations and maintains exceptional effectiveness. Regularly reviewing and responding to this details implies that your Drupal internet site is not going to only be present-day but will also provide your buyers proficiently.

In summary, a sturdy Drupal servicing system is essential for a safe, performant, and consumer-centric Internet site. By knowing the necessity of servicing, addressing widespread difficulties, subsequent finest methods, employing Sophisticated procedures, and measuring achievement correctly, you'll be able to make sure your Drupal web-site continues to prosper in an at any time-evolving electronic landscape.

Report this page